Summary Translation of Appendix C 13

Extract from Sing Tao Jih Pao on 28.2.76

Kaifong Leaders Decided on Three Phases to

Retain the Governor

Kaifong leaders in Hong Kong and Kowloon had a meeting yesterday to discuss the steps which they should take to seek approval for the extension of the Governor's term of office. They agreed on three courses of action, i.e. :

(a) they will petition to H.M. the Queen;

(b) when the Secretary of State arrived in Hong Kong

they would send a delegation to seek an interview with him and present their request; and

(c) if necessary, they would send a small group of

Kai Fong representatives to London and approach the U.K. Government direct.

In the meeting the Honourable Adviser to the meeting Mr. WONG Tin- wing had drafted a petition for the meeting's consideration. During their meeting on 27th February 1976, it was also agreed to form a special committee to press for the extension of the Governor's service with Messrs. WOO Shing-suen, SO Ching, SHUM Lo-yeung, TSO Siu-chung and WONG Tin-wing as its members. The Honourable Adviser's draft petition summarised Sir Murry MacLehose's achievements since he has been the Governor of Hong Kong in 1971.
